top of page

WordPress hız optimizasyonu: Core Web Vitals skoru iyileştirme

WordPress hız optimizasyonu, sitenizin hem Google sıralamalarında hem de kullanıcı deneyiminde önemli bir fark yaratır. Core Web Vitals metrikleri — LCP, CLS ve INP — artık doğrudan sıralama faktörü olarak değerlendirilmekte; yavaş yüklenen sayfalar hem organik görünürlük hem de dönüşüm açısından ciddi kayıplara yol açmaktadır.

Hosting seçimi ve sunucu altyapısı

WordPress hız optimizasyonunun temeli sunucu altyapısıdır. Paylaşımlı hosting üzerinde ne kadar önbellek veya görsel optimizasyonu yapılırsa yapılsın, yavaş bir sunucu kaynaklı gecikmeyi (TTFB) gidermek mümkün değildir.

LiteSpeed vs Apache:

LiteSpeed web sunucusu, Apache'ye kıyasla PHP isteklerini çok daha hızlı işler. LiteSpeed Cache eklentisi ile birlikte kullanıldığında sayfa yükleme süresi belirgin biçimde kısalır. Hostinger, Namecheap ve bazı Türk hosting sağlayıcıları LiteSpeed sunucu seçeneği sunar.

Öneriler:

  • Paylaşımlı hostingden VPS veya managed WordPress hostinge (Kinsta, WP Engine, Rocket.net) geçişi değerlendirin

  • Sunucu lokasyonu ziyaretçi kitlenize yakın olmalı; Türkiye trafiği için Avrupa veya yerel veri merkezli hostingler tercih edilmeli

  • PHP versiyonu 8.1 veya üzeri kullanılmalı; eski PHP versiyonları performansı düşürür

Önbellek eklentisi kurulumu ve yapılandırması

WordPress hız optimizasyonunda önbellek eklentisi en büyük tek etki faktörüdür. Önbellek, dinamik olarak üretilen PHP sayfalarını statik HTML olarak saklar; böylece her istek için veritabanı sorgusu ve PHP işlemi gerekmez.

Popüler seçenekler:

  • WP Rocket: Ücretli ($59/yıl), en kapsamlı ve kullanımı en kolay çözüm. CSS/JS küçültme, lazy loading, preload ve CDN entegrasyonu dahildir.

  • LiteSpeed Cache: Ücretsiz, LiteSpeed sunucu kullananlar için birinci tercih. Sunucu düzeyinde önbellek sağlar.

  • W3 Total Cache: Ücretsiz, esnekliği yüksek ancak yapılandırması karmaşık. İleri düzey kullanıcılar için uygundur.

Önbellek eklentisi kurulduktan sonra mutlaka mobil ve masaüstü için ayrı önbellek etkin olmalı, önbellek ömrü (cache lifetime) en az 12 saat olarak ayarlanmalıdır.

Görsel optimizasyonu: WebP, lazy loading ve sıkıştırma

Görseller WordPress sitelerinde sayfa ağırlığının genellikle %60–80'ini oluşturur. WordPress hız optimizasyonu için görsel sıkıştırma ve modern format kullanımı kritiktir.

WebP formatına geçiş:

Imagify, ShortPixel veya Smush eklentileri görselleri otomatik olarak WebP formatına dönüştürür. WebP, JPEG'e göre ortalama %25–30 daha küçük dosya boyutu sunarken görsel kaliteyi korur. Eklentiler eski tarayıcılar için JPEG/PNG fallback otomatik sağlar.

Lazy loading:

WordPress 5.5'ten itibaren native lazy loading (loading="lazy") varsayılan olarak aktiftir. Ancak LCP (Largest Contentful Paint) görseli — genellikle hero bölümündeki kapak görseli — lazy loading dışında bırakılmalıdır. Bu görsel mümkün olduğunca erken yüklenmelidir.

Pratik kural: Kapak görseline loading="eager" veya fetchpriority="high" ekleyin; diğer tüm görseller lazy load ile yüklensin.

CSS/JS küçültme, CDN ve veritabanı optimizasyonu

CSS ve JavaScript küçültme:

WP Rocket veya W3 Total Cache ile CSS ve JS dosyaları küçültülür (minify) ve birleştirilir (concatenate). Bu işlem sayfa başına yapılan HTTP istek sayısını azaltır. Dikkat: bazı eklentilerin JS dosyaları birleştirildiğinde site işlevsiz hale gelebilir; her değişiklik test edilmeli.

CDN kullanımı:

Cloudflare ücretsiz planı, statik varlıkları (CSS, JS, görseller) dünyanın farklı noktalarındaki sunuculardan sunar. Türkiye'deki ziyaretçiler için sunucu yanıt süresi belirgin biçimde kısalır. Kurulum için Cloudflare hesabı açıp domain'in NS kayıtlarını Cloudflare'e yönlendirmek yeterlidir.

Veritabanı optimizasyonu:

WordPress zamanla gereksiz revizyon, taslak ve geçici veri biriktirir. WP-Optimize veya WP Rocket'ın veritabanı temizleme özelliği ile ayda bir kez otomatik temizleme planlanmalıdır.

Ağır eklentileri tespit etme:

Query Monitor eklentisi, her sayfa yüklemesinde yapılan veritabanı sorgu sayısını ve yavaş sorguları gösterir. Yüksek sorgu sayısına neden olan eklentiler tespit edilerek alternatif veya daha hafif seçeneklerle değiştirilmelidir.

LCP ve CLS iyileştirme

LCP (Largest Contentful Paint):

LCP hedefi 2,5 saniyenin altında olmaktır. İyileştirme için:

  • Hero görselini preload edin: <link rel="preload" as="image" href="...">

  • Kritik CSS'i inline edip render-blocking kaynakları erteleyln

  • Sunucu yanıt süresini (TTFB) 600ms altına indirin

CLS (Cumulative Layout Shift):

CLS skoru 0,1'in altında olmalıdır. Yaygın CLS kaynakları: boyutsuz görseller (width ve height attribute eksik), geç yüklenen reklamlar, web fontları için FOUT (Flash of Unstyled Text). Her görsele HTML'de açık width ve height attribute'u eklemek CLS'i anında iyileştirir.

Sık Sorulan Sorular

WordPress hız optimizasyonu için en önce ne yapılmalı?

İlk adım PageSpeed Insights veya GTmetrix ile mevcut durumu ölçmektir. Rapor hangi alanların en fazla puan kaybına neden olduğunu gösterir. Çoğu sitede hosting kalitesi ve görsel optimizasyonu en büyük iyileştirme fırsatını sunar.

Önbellek eklentisi kullanmak yeterli midir?

Önbellek tek başına önemli iyileştirme sağlar ancak WordPress hız optimizasyonu için yeterli değildir. Hosting kalitesi, görsel boyutları ve gereksiz eklenti yükü de aynı derecede önemlidir.

Core Web Vitals skoru SEO sıralamalarını doğrudan etkiler mi?

Google, Core Web Vitals'ı sıralama sinyali olarak kullandığını resmi olarak doğrulamıştır. Ancak etkisi içerik kalitesi ve backlink gücü kadar belirleyici değildir. Rekabetçi bir nişte birbirine yakın iki site arasındaki farkı kapatan faktör olabilir.

Blakfy olarak WordPress hız optimizasyonu, Core Web Vitals iyileştirmesi ve teknik SEO denetimi konularında işletmelere danışmanlık hizmeti sunuyoruz.

bottom of page